In Math we are working on number sense 0-10. We ran math centers for the first time this week! We are learning through hands-on experiences and are having so much fun doing so. As we learn about the numbers we are showing them on ten frames, tally marks, and are decomposing them as we go. A great activity to work on at home for number sense is Subitizing!  You can find a great subitizing song/video here!
